Technically, Trap Quest may not be the most polished in terms of interface. Built on the Inform engine, its layout can feel a bit cluttered and may not be as visually appealing as some modern games. However, it offers features like a "dark mode" to ease the viewing experience. While it might take a moment to acclimate to the interface, the immersive storytelling more than compensates for any initial awkwardness.
